Removal and installation of double clutch (Skoda Yeti 5L)

1. Clutch assemblies require special handling because all components are balanced during production. If the parts rotate relative to each other during assembly, the balance is disturbed, which reduces the service life of the clutch and the comfort of gear shifting. For this reason, clutches are supplied as a single piece with a retaining ring installed to prevent them from rotating relative to each other. Clutch assembly details are shown in the illustration. If the clutch components have slipped or the plate supports have been raised, the large and, if necessary, the small support plates can be inserted by hand into all the inner plates with a slight torque. In particular, the clutch cover must always be installed in the same position.

16.1. Double Clutch Assembly Details 1. Retaining ring; 2. Plate support, do not try to remove or lift even a little; 3. Dual clutch housing with installed clutch "K2"; 4. Sealing rings, 4 pcs.; 5. Outer plates, 4 pcs.; 6. Inner plates, 4 pcs.; 7. Thrust washer; 8. Retaining ring, after removing to install new plates, install a new ring of the same thickness; 9. Clutch cover; 10. Retaining ring, must be replaced, do not install wave retaining rings




Removal/installing the clutch cover



2. The clutch cover is held in place by a retaining ring, after which the cover can be lifted. The cover and retaining ring must be replaced after removal. Never install a new cap with a hammer, do not grasp it by the center hole and do not lubricate the center seal, otherwise a leak will occur (see illustration 16.2a). Handle the new cover only as shown in Illustration 16.2b.

3. Remove the DSG (see Section 15).

4. Unscrew the service hole plug (In the illustration 21.11 Chapter 1) next to the rocking support, and then unscrew the overflow tube located behind this plug - approximately 5 liters of working fluid will pour out. Screw in the overflow tube.



5. Unscrew the lid (1 in illustration 21.6 Chapter 1), tilt the filter (3) slightly so that the working fluid flows from it into the DSG, and remove the filter. Install a new sealing ring (2), after lubricating it with DSG fluid.

6. Wet the sealing ring in the receiving sleeve (see illustration 21.7 Chapter 1), install a new filter and tighten its cover with a torque of 20 Nm.

7. Fill the DSG with fresh working fluid (see Section 21 Chapter 1).

8. Remove the clutch cover retaining ring and lift it up with a screwdriver.

9. The clutch cover can be supplied with or without a bushing. Installation of a clutch without a sleeve is described in paragraphs 10-13, and installation of a clutch with a sleeve is described in paragraphs 14-16.

10. Clean the T10302 mounting sleeve and make sure it is free of scratches. Make sure the new clutch cover is dry and there is no grease on the center seal. Clean the end of the clutch shaft if necessary. Only the seal on the outer edge of the cover can be lubricated with DSG working fluid. Place the T10302 bushing on a flat surface.

11. Deform the center seal (In the illustration) new clutch cover (A). To do this, push the cover evenly and horizontally onto the T10302 bushing - the sealing edge is brought to the installation position. Remove the sleeve from the cover in an upward direction and install the sleeve onto the end of the clutch shaft.

12. Close the lid (And in the illustration) through the T10302 bushing and evenly move it into the installation position. Do not allow even the slightest distortion.

Note: Tool T30109 is used to mount the DSG.


13. Install a new retaining ring. While the retaining ring is not installed, you can carefully pry the cover off with a screwdriver (1 in the illustration) in its position (arrow).

14. Do not remove the sleeve from the cover. Make sure the new clutch cover is dry and there is no grease on the center seal. Clean the end of the clutch shaft if necessary. Only the seal on the outer edge of the cover can be lubricated with DSG working fluid. Place the T10302 bushing on a flat surface.



15. Install the cover together with the bushing (see illustration), without allowing even the slightest distortion. Install a new snap ring. While the retaining ring is not installed, you can carefully pry the cover off with a screwdriver (1 in illustration 16.13) in its position (arrow).

16. After installing the retaining ring, the sleeve can be removed.

Clutch removal/installation



17. Remove the DSG (see Section 15) and secure it vertically so that the clutch is on top.

18. Remove the clutch cover (see subsection above). Remove the retaining ring (arrow on the illustration) and remove the cover (1).

19. Remove the retaining ring (see illustration). Measure the thickness of this ring and prepare a new retaining ring of the same thickness.

20. Carefully remove the clutch (And in the illustration) in the direction of the arrow without turning it to prevent the support plate or other clutch parts from falling. If the clutch has fallen apart, reassemble it as shown in Illustration 16.1.

21. Pull out the drive shaft (And in the illustration) pump and set it aside. The drive shaft is inserted only after the new clutch has been installed.

22. The details of the supplied clutch are shown in the illustration. The cover of the new clutch is not secured with a retaining ring (5), it is seated in the clutch with a slight tension to prevent the clutch parts from falling during transportation. The cover can be carefully removed before installing the clutch.

16.22. Details of the supplied clutch 1. Clutch; 2. 10 retaining rings of different thickness, with a step of 0.1 mm; 3. Clutch cover, a sleeve is installed to protect the central seal, which should not be removed; 4. Cover retaining ring 3; 5. Cover retaining ring 3, do not install wave rings


23. Remove the new clutch from its packaging, pressing down on its cover to prevent the cover and the backing plate underneath from sliding off the inner plates. Pay attention to the correct position of the four piston rings (And in the illustration), - their joints should not be located on top of each other. Try turning the rings - they should move freely, without jamming.

24. Make sure the label is present (And in the illustration) on the clutch. If there is no mark, apply it with a marker opposite the tab (B) of the clutch cover. When installing, the cover tab will need to be positioned opposite this mark. If the cover is being installed on a new clutch, remove the retaining ring (1).

25. Carefully remove the clutch cover in the direction of the arrows (see illustration) and put it aside. Do not remove or attempt to lift the plate support, otherwise the plates may rotate. Place the clutch aside so that it does not fall.

26. Install the T10303 holding device onto the mounting surface (arrow on the illustration) clutch covers.

27. Ask an assistant to hold the T10303 device (see illustration) and carefully install the clutch in the direction opposite to the arrow (see illustration 16.20), without allowing it to fall. Do not remove tool T10303 until the clutch cover has been installed.

28. Select a 2mm thick snap ring from the clutch kit and temporarily install it (see illustration 16.19).

29. Install the MP3-447 or VW387 holder with a plunger indicator on the DSG flange. Press the indicator plunger against the DSG drive shaft (see illustration 16.29a), reset the indicator, lift the clutch to the stop and record the result. Then press the plunger of the indicator against the hub of the large support plate in the gap of the retaining ring (see illustration 16.29b). reset the indicator, lift the clutch to the stop and record the result. Determine the thickness of the required retaining ring. To do this, subtract the first measurement from the second result, add 1.85 mm and round down to 0.1 mm. Remove the temporarily installed 2.0 mm thick snap ring and replace it with a snap ring of the required thickness.

Note: Retaining rings may only be installed once.


30. Insert the pump drive shaft, turning it slightly (see illustration).

31. Insert the clutch cover so that its tab (In illustration 16.24) was aligned with the mark (A) on the clutch. Install a new retaining ring (1).

32. Remove tool T10303 and install the clutch cover (see subsection above).

33. Install the DSG and, using the diagnostic tool, apply the basic settings for the unit "Mechatronic".
